The 34-year-old Bergen-born tenor/soprano saxophonist-composer Marius Neset presents his new recording Viaduct and makes his boldest, most restlessly diverse statement to date. On his fifth album for leading European label ACT, Neset organically integrates a wide-ranging, colourful kaleidoscope of influences with his compelling compositions/arrangements for a pair of extended suites. line upMarius Neset / tenor & soprano saxophones
Ivo Neame / piano
Jim Hart / vibraphone, marimba & percussion
Petter Eldh / double bass
Anton Eger / drums & percussion
London Sinfonietta conducted by Geoffrey Paterson
All music composed and arranged by Marius Neset
Produced by Marius Neset
Recorded by Jon Bailey at AIR Studios, London, 19th and 20th December, 2018. Assistant recording engineer: Laurence Anslow.
Mixed by August Wanngren at Virkeligheden
Mastered by Thomas Eberger at Stockholm Mastering
